WebTo revive a dying majesty palm with dried out leaves, adjust the conditions by misting the leaves to increase the humidity, soak the root ball in a basin of water, locate the palm in indirect light rather then direct sunlight and trim back any dried leaves to … WebOverwatering a palm tree can lead to symptoms such as yellowing leaves, droopy and pale leaves, pests, mold growth, and root rot. To save an overwatered palm tree, remove dead parts, transfer it to well-draining soil, and give it appropriate water. Avoid placing the tree in a shady area and let the soil dry between watering.
